Clinical Question: Can text message be used for epidemiologic data collection and accurate injury reporting in recreational and club sport participation? Clinical Bottom Line: Text message may be advantageous for injury surveillance in recreational exercise and club sport participation. This novel method may provide a more complete understanding of injury rates as this tool allows for more immediate recall of injury exposures and incidences. Further, data suggest that injuries are reported more often via text message compared to those reported to health care personnel.
